The Shellfish (Specification of Crustaceans) (Wales) Regulations 2002
Title, commencement and application1.
(1)
These Regulations are called the Shellfish (Specification of Crustaceans) (Wales) Regulations 2002 and come into force on 5th August 2002.
(2)
These Regulations apply to Wales and the sea adjacent to Wales out as far as the seaward boundary of the territorial sea.
Specification of crustaceans2.
Crabs are hereby specified for the purposes of section 1(1) of the Sea Fisheries (Shellfish) Act 1967.
These Regulations, which apply only in relation to Wales, add crabs to the types of shellfish falling within section 1(1) of the Sea Fisheries (Shellfish) Act 1967 (“the 1967 Act”). This enables several or regulated fisheries for crabs to be established by orders under that section.
Scallops and queens were specified for the purpose of section 1 of the 1967 Act by the Shellfish (Specification of Molluscs) Regulations 1987 (S.I. 1987/218).
